Exploring the Vatican Museums: From the Panoramic Terrace to Ancient Art

Vatican Museums and Sistine Chapel Semi-Private Tour - Exploring the Vatican Museums: From the Panoramic Terrace to Ancient Art

The tour begins at the Vatican Museums entrance, where skipping typical lines allows you to enter through a panoramic terrace. Here, stunning views of St. Peter’s dome and the Vatican gardens serve as a perfect backdrop for photos. The guide then guides you through the museums, highlighting key features and masterpieces from various cultures and civilizations.

You’ll see the Pio Clementine Museum, renowned for its ancient Greek and Roman statues, including the Laocoon group. The Tapestry Hall impresses visitors with its enormous size, while other highlights include the Hall of the Read and more. The tour’s focus is on the most significant works, making it an accessible overview for visitors new to the Vatican’s art collections.

Practical Details: Meeting Point, Timing, and Group Size

Vatican Museums and Sistine Chapel Semi-Private Tour - Practical Details: Meeting Point, Timing, and Group Size

The tour begins at Viale Vaticano, 100, and it’s recommended to arrive 10 minutes early. The start time at 2:30 pm provides a convenient afternoon option, especially after morning sightseeing. The maximum group size of 10 ensures a calm, intimate environment, and the tour ends back at the meeting point.

A moderate physical fitness level is recommended due to the walking involved, and comfortable shoes are advised. The tour is also suitable for those with service animals. Keep in mind, the dress code requires covered shoulders and knees, as entry to places of worship and museums is strictly controlled.
